About This Item

Tucson, AZ: Dennis McMillan Publications, 2005. First U.S. Edition. Hardcover. Very good in very good dust jacket. Signed by author. DJ is in a plastic sleeve.. 469 p. There was an earlier French edition printed in 2004.
